One of the primary reasons for understanding anxiety in children is to ensure that children receive the necessary support and resources to manage their anxiety. Anxiety can be a debilitating condition that can impact a child's daily life, including their academic performance, social interactions, and overall quality of life. When left untreated, anxiety can also lead to more severe mental health conditions such as depression and substance abuse.
By understanding anxiety in children, parents and caregivers can identify the signs and symptoms of anxiety and seek appropriate treatment for their child. Early intervention is crucial in managing anxiety and can prevent it from developing into more severe mental health conditions.

Another purpose of understanding anxiety in children is to reduce the stigma surrounding mental health conditions. Mental health conditions are often stigmatized, and children may feel ashamed or embarrassed about their anxiety.
